Definitions For Cascade

noun

  • A mountain range in the northwestern United States extending through Washington and Oregon and northern California; a part of the Coast Range
  • A sudden downpour (as of tears or sparks etc) likened to a rain shower
  • A succession of stages or operations or processes or units
  • A small waterfall or series of small waterfalls
  • A small, steep waterfall ; especially : one that is part of a series of waterfalls
  • A large amount of something that flows or hangs down
  • A large number of things that happen quickly in a series

verb

  • Arrange (open windows) on a computer desktop so that they overlap each other, with the title bars visible
  • Rush down in big quantities, like a cascade
  • To flow or hang down in large amounts

Examples of Cascade in a Sentence

  • Her hair was arranged in a cascade of curls.
  • That decision set off a cascade of events.
  • The water cascades over the rocks.
  • Her hair cascaded down around her shoulders.
